Stantec is looking for a full‑time professional with strong project management and roadway engineering capabilities to lead various‑sized roadway study and design projects for state departments of transportation and local municipalities. As a project team leader, the Project Manager will work closely together with a project engineer, roadway designers, traffic engineers and other team members to deliver location and alignment studies, preliminary and final design plans, and other technical documents common to roadway engineering projects. The Project Manager will serve as the primary client and public‑facing contact for the project. The Project Manager will provide supervision as needed; act as an advisor and be actively involved in meeting schedules and resolving problems as they arise. They will be responsible for managing the scope and integration of subconsultants and employees. It is also anticipated that the Project Manager will support business development and the delivery of proposals.
